Academic Comparison between Wells and Rabbinical College of Long Island

Wells College and Rabbinical College of Long Island are frequently compared when students or parents prepare college admissions. Both Schools are four-year, private (not-for-profit) and located in New York

Comparison at a Glance

The following list compares two colleges briefly in important perspectives. You can compare them with comprehensive information on full comparison page.

  • Both schools are four-year, private (not-for-profit) schools.
  • Wells has more expensive tuition & fees ($35,166) than Rabbinical College of Long Island ($10,290).
  • Wells has more students with 357 students while Rabbinical College of Long Island has 159 students.
  • Wells has a lower number of students per faculty with 8 to 1 while Rabbinical College of Long Island's ratio is 18 to 1.
  • Wells has more full-time faculties with 38 faculties while Rabbinical College of Long Island has 8 full-time faculties.
